The ticket office at Bristol Parkway operates with extended hours to accommodate your travel plans – from 6:00 AM to 8:00 PM on weekdays, 7:00 AM to 6:00 PM on Saturdays, and 8:30 AM to 7:00 PM on Sundays. For tech-savvy travellers, ticket machines and facilities to collect tickets bought online are readily available. If you have a smartcard, rest assured Bristol Parkway issues and validates them.
Accessibility doesn't fall short either. With step-free access throughout the station, including lifts that connect the platforms, those requiring assistance can have their concerns met, with a staff-ready helpline offering support round the clock. Even the entrance has a clever setup for passenger drop-offs and pick-ups.
Passenger comfort is prioritized with clean waiting areas, essential refreshment facilities, and a handy ATM machine. Cyclists can safely store their bikes in extensive storage facilities, while drivers benefit from a large parking area operated by APCOA Parking (UK) Limited, with over 1,100 spaces available 24/7.

Narborough station is equipped to make your journey as smooth and straightforward as possible, although some facilities are limited. The ticket office is open from Monday to Saturday, 06:40 to 13:00, but unfortunately, there are no ticket machines available at the station. You can easily collect pre-purchased tickets from the ticket office, making it convenient for travelers to plan ahead.
Offering a degree of accessibility, the station has step-free access to the Leicester-bound platform and a ramp from the road to the Birmingham-bound platform. Keep in mind, however, that there is no interchange between platforms. CCTV cameras monitor the premises, ensuring added safety for your journey.
